BLOKS (00325) rose more than 11%, bringing its cumulative gain over two days to over 20%. At the time of writing, the stock was up 11.16% to HK$69.75, with a turnover of HK$147 million. The company reported that for 2025, it achieved revenue of approximately RMB 2.913 billion, a year-on-year increase of 30%. Gross profit reached about RMB 1.364 billion, up 15.7% compared to the previous year. Profit attributable to owners of the parent company was approximately RMB 634 million, marking a turnaround from a loss to a profit. Additionally, BLOKS recently showcased over 300 products across more than 10 series, including Star Edition, Galaxy Edition, Beyond Edition, Legend Edition, Miracle Edition, Nature Collection, and Enchanted Tales, in the "Building Block Vehicles" and "Building Block Figures" categories at the 2026 Thailand Toy Expo. New products from the Saint Seiya and DC series made their debut. Everbright Securities noted that since 2026, BLOKS has made significant progress in IP collaborations, category expansion, and overseas channels. The IP portfolio has been deepened: during the Global Partners Conference in March, the company announced new authorized collaborations with Godzilla, Barbie, Fast & Furious, and Ford, and launched a co-branded product titled "Heroes Unlimited × Havoc in Heaven." The Building Block Vehicle category is being emphasized as the second strategic category, with collaborations planned around the Fast & Furious and Ford IPs. Overseas expansion is accelerating: in April, BLOKS made its first appearance at the Thailand Toy Expo, exhibiting over 300 products from 17 IPs.
